Scars

Some scars you’ve got there. Like you tried to rip your own heart out. Like you knew that he would come by and sweep you off your feet and never catch you once you’re falling back down. Some scars you’ve got there. Like you tried to rip your own heart out. Like the love he never showed and the way he twisted your feelings would’ve gotten you far in the race of humans. Some scars you’ve got there. Like you tried to rip your own heart out. Like his unfamiliar kiss on your adam’s apple could forgive the things left unsaid and the smiles that never came. Some scars you’ve got there. You let him rip your own heart out.
